Walkman222222 asked:
What are the black shadow demon/shade things that you can see floating and flowwing people around in the game sometimes? They're not clickable or targetable but they're just there?

They're Haunted Mementos that people have picked up in previous world events involving the Scourge. They are not available anymore, and if someone has one in one of their bags, you can sometimes see a ghostly figure following them around.
Supposedly you can find them on the AH (or sell them yourself), but expect to pay an arm and a leg for one.
Edit: It's also possible it came from a Haunted Herring.

Techvoodooguy asked:
Did the warlock class quest in Stormwind that had you assassinate the noble get removed? I loved that questline!
Yes, all class quests were removed with Cataclysm. There might be one or two still around in some other, non-class form, but I don't know of them if they are.
